1. Registered Nurse (RN)
Role and Responsibilities
Registered Nurses in Five Towns are in high demand, particularly in hospitals and private clinics. They provide patient care, administer medications, and collaborate with doctors to implement treatment plans. Their role is crucial in ensuring quality patient outcomes and fostering a positive healthcare experience.
Qualifications and Skills
- Licensure: Active RN license in the state
- Education: Associate's or Bachelor's degree in Nursing
- Skills: Excellent communication, critical thinking, and empathetic patient care
2. Medical Laboratory Technician
Role and Responsibilities
Medical Laboratory Technicians perform essential tests that aid in diagnosing diseases. Working primarily in diagnostic labs and hospitals, they analyze body fluids, cells, and tissues, providing key insights that physicians rely on for treatment planning.
Qualifications and Skills
- Education: Associate’s degree in Clinical Laboratory Science
- Certification: Certification from an accredited program
- Skills: Detail-oriented, analytical, and proficient in laboratory technology
3. Physical Therapist
Role and Responsibilities
As the population in Five Towns ages, the demand for Physical Therapists has grown. They work with patients to restore mobility and manage pain through exercise, hands-on therapy, and patient education.
Qualifications and Skills
- Education: Doctorate of Physical Therapy (DPT)
- Licensure: State licensure as a Physical Therapist
- Skills: Strong interpersonal skills, problem-solving, and physical stamina
4. Healthcare Administrator
Role and Responsibilities
Healthcare Administrators manage operations in various healthcare settings. Their responsibilities include overseeing staff, budgeting, and ensuring compliance with health regulations and policies. Their role is pivotal in driving the efficiency and effectiveness of healthcare services.
Qualifications and Skills
- Education: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Healthcare Administration
- Skills: Leadership, communication, and strategic planning
5. Mental Health Counselor
Role and Responsibilities
Mental Health Counselors in Five Towns provide valuable support to individuals dealing with mental health disorders. They offer therapy, develop treatment plans, and work with patients to improve their mental and emotional wellbeing.
Qualifications and Skills
- Education: Master’s degree in Counseling or Psychology
- Licensure: State licensure as a counselor
- Skills: Empathy, active listening, and excellent communication
